Academic Credentials
Academic credentials are paramount when seeking a teaching position in international schools in China. A Bachelor’s degree is the foundational requirement, akin to standards observed in the UK educational system. However, the relevance of your degree subject can significantly influence hiring decisions.
For instance, candidates aspiring to teach specialized subjects such as English or Mathematics will benefit from possessing a degree in those specific fields. Conversely, those interested in primary education may find that a degree in Education or a closely related discipline enhances their employability.
Furthermore, holding a postgraduate degree in Education, such as a Master’s or Doctorate, can substantially improve your prospects of securing a teaching role in an international school in China. This advanced qualification serves as a testament to your expertise and commitment to the field.
Teaching Certification
In addition to relevant academic qualifications, possessing a recognized teaching certification is essential for educators aiming to work in international schools in China. This certification, often referred to as a teaching license or credential, validates your qualifications to instruct in a classroom setting.
In the UK, obtaining a teaching certification typically involves completing a Postgraduate Certificate in Education (PGCE) or a comparable teacher training program. This certification is a critical component of your professional profile, ensuring that you meet the necessary standards for effective teaching.
TEFL Certification
For those intending to teach English as a foreign language in China, acquiring a TEFL (Teaching English as a Foreign Language) certification is indispensable. This credential equips educators with the necessary skills and methodologies to effectively teach English to non-native speakers.
TEFL courses are available in both online and in-person formats, generally requiring a minimum of 120 hours of coursework. Some international schools may mandate a TEFL certification even for non-English teaching positions, as it demonstrates your capability to operate within an ESL (English as a Second Language) context.

Teaching Experience
Most international schools in China prefer candidates with a minimum of two years of teaching experience. This requirement indicates that you are well-acquainted with the demands of the teaching profession and can effectively manage classroom responsibilities. Experience in international schools or familiarity with the International Baccalaureate (IB) curriculum is particularly advantageous, as it demonstrates your ability to adapt to diverse educational frameworks.
Language Proficiency
While fluency in Mandarin is not a prerequisite for teaching in international schools in China, possessing some level of language proficiency can enhance your effectiveness in communication with students, parents, and colleagues. This skill can also enrich your overall experience while residing in China.
Moreover, international schools value educators who can contribute a global perspective to their teaching methodologies. Proficiency in additional languages and an understanding of various cultures can serve as significant assets, enriching the educational environment and fostering inclusivity.
Navigating the Application Process
Having outlined the essential qualifications for teaching in international schools in China, it is imperative to understand the application process.
International schools typically advertise vacancies on their official websites or through international education job boards. The application process generally involves submitting a comprehensive CV and a tailored cover letter, followed by an interview, which may be conducted virtually. This process mirrors job applications in the UK, albeit with some additional considerations.
Upon receiving a job offer, candidates must apply for a work visa, a process that can take several weeks. It is advisable to initiate this process promptly to ensure a smooth transition to your new role.
